Pay in context

Top pay as a share of expenses

In 2023, the highest total compensation at THE DURRANI FOUNDATION equaled 18% of the organization's total expenses. The median for health care organizations is 4%.

This organization (2023)
18%
Sector median
4%
Middle half of sector
1% to 13%

Based on 13,830 health care organizations, each measured at its most recent filing year with reported expenses and compensation.

Common questions about THE DURRANI FOUNDATION

What are THE DURRANI FOUNDATION's revenue and expenses?

In 2023, THE DURRANI FOUNDATION reported $10 in total revenue and $72k in total expenses on its IRS Form 990.
